WebThere are also some very simple, but less accurate, methods available. One of them is adding 2.5 inches (7.6 cm) to the average of the parent's height for a boy and subtracting 2.5 inches (7.6 cm) for a girl. The second calculator above is based on this method. WebHeight conversion Feet to Inches conversion. One feet is equal to 12 inches: 1ft = 12″ Inches to centimeters conversion. One inch is equal to 2.54 centimeters: 1″ = 2.54cm. Centimeters to meters conversion. One centimeter is equal to 0.01 meter: 1cm = 0.01m. One meter is equal to 100 centimeters: 1m = 100cm
